According to available records, Beatrice de Beauchamp was born in 1107 in Bedford, Bedfordshire, England, the child of Robert de Beauchamp and Adeliza Matilda Tallebois. Following those early years, Beatrice de Beauchamp married Hugh de Morville, and their family grew to include Malcolm de Morville, Ada de Morville, Roger de Morville, Maude de Morville, Sir Hugh de Morville II, Richard de Morville and Joan de Morville. In the later years of life, Beatrice de Beauchamp died in 1162 in Burgh by Sands, Cumberland, England.
